Google's new Gemini API Agent Skill patches the knowledge gap AI models have with their own SDKs

Google's Gemini API enhances AI coding assistants.

Google has introduced an 'Agent Skill' for its Gemini API that resolves a critical issue faced by AI coding assistants: the lack of awareness about their own updates and best practices. This new skill provides coding agents with current information on models, SDKs, and sample code, leading to significant performance improvements. In tests involving 117 tasks, the Gemini 3.1 Pro Preview model's success rate surged from 28.2% to 96.6%, showcasing the skill's effectiveness, especially for newer models.
